次の記事では、FreeCADを見ていきます。 これは 無料のオープンソースソフトウェア、3DモデラーおよびCADソフトウェア。 製品設計および/または機械工学にも使用されます。 数年前、同僚がすでにこのプログラムについて教えてくれました。その記事を参照してください。 ここで。 FreeCADは 100%オープンソースで非常にモジュール化。 拡張機能のおかげで、この無数のカスタマイズとプログラミングの可能性を可能にします。
FreeCADは C ++およびPython言語でプログラムされています。 プログラムは OpenCasCadeに基づく、これは強力なジオメトリカーネルです。 STEP、IGES、STLなどの多くのオープンファイル形式を読み取って生成します。 また、そのインターフェースはQtFreeCADで構築されています。 これは、Windows、Mac OS X、およびGnu / Linuxプラットフォームでまったく同じように機能することを意味します。
多くの最新の3DCADモデラーと同様に、XNUMX次元コンポーネントがあります。 3Dモデルから詳細設計を抽出する。 これにより、2D図面を作成できますが、直接2Dデザイン(AutoCAD LTなど)は目標ではなく、アニメーションや有機的な形状(Maya、3ds Max、Cinema 4Dなど)も目標ではありません。
FreeCADは CATIA、SolidWorks、SolidEdge、ArchiCAD、またはAutodeskRevitと同様の作業環境。 パラメトリックモデリング技術を使用し、モジュラーソフトウェアアーキテクチャを備えています。 これにより、システムのコアを変更することなく、機能を簡単に追加できます。 モデリングにより、プロジェクトを簡単に変更できるようになり、モデルの履歴に戻ってパラメータを変更できるようになります。
このプログラムは、機械工学と製品設計を直接対象としています。 しかし、それも明確にする必要があります 幅広いエンジニアリング用途に適合、建築やその他の専門分野など。
FreeCADはまだ開発の初期段階にありますそのため、すでに多数の(そして増え続ける)機能のリストが提供されていますが、まだ長い道のりがあります。 特に、最も人気のある商用ソリューションと比較した場合。 そのため、このプログラムが実稼働環境で使用するのに十分に開発されていない場合があります。 ただし、熱狂的なユーザーのコミュニティは急速に成長しています。 今日、FreeCADで開発された高品質のプロジェクトの多くの例をすでに見つけることができます。 これらのプロジェクトとそのすべてのドキュメントは、 プロジェクトのウェブサイト.
UbuntuおよびUbuntuベースのシステムにFreeCADをインストールする
多くのGnu / LinuxディストリビューションはUbuntuに基づいており、リポジトリを共有しています。 公式の亜種(Kubuntu、Lubuntu、Xubuntu)の他に、Linux Mint、Voyagerなどの非公式のディストリビューションがあります。 以下に示すインストールオプションは、これらのシステムと互換性があります。
公式Ubuntuリポジトリからインストールします
FreeCADはUbuntuリポジトリから入手でき、ソフトウェアセンターから、またはターミナルで次のコマンド(Ctrl + Alt + T)を使用してインストールできます。
sudo apt install freecad
安定したPPAからインストール
これらのコマンドをターミナル(Ctrl + Alt + T)に書き込んだり、コピーして貼り付けたりすることで、このプログラムをインストールすることもできます。 PPAを追加します そして彼らのページに示されているようにプログラムをインストールします 発射台。 「安定した」PPAを追加するには、次のように記述する必要があります。
sudo add-apt-repository ppa:freecad-maintainers/freecad-stable
ここで、ソフトウェアリストを更新することを忘れないでください。 これは通常どおり次のように記述します。
sudo apt update
Updateは、使用可能なパッケージのリストをサーバーと同期します。 これで、ターミナルに入力して(Ctrl + Alt + T)、FreeCADとそのドキュメントをインストールするだけで済みます。
sudo apt install freecad freecad-doc && apt upgrade
最後のアップデートは、新しいパッケージのバージョンをインストールするのに役立ちます。 これは、コンピューターにインストールされているすべてのプログラムに適用されます。 これで、このプログラムを実行できます。 ダッシュでそれを探すか、このコマンドを使用して開くだけです。 FreeCADの安定バージョン:
freecad
FreeCADをアンインストールする
ターミナルを開いて(Ctrl + Alt + T)、次のように書き込むことで、このプログラムをコンピューターから削除できます。
sudo apt remove freecad && sudo apt autoremove
インストールを実行するために、アプリケーションの公式PPAを使用することを選択し、それを削除したい場合は、ターミナルで次のコマンドを記述できます(Ctrl + Alt + T)。
sudo add-apt-repository -r ppa:freecad-maintainers/freecad-stable
とてもよさそうです。 専門家がそれを使用したかどうか、そしてそれがどのように進んだかを教えてくれるといいでしょう。
新しいFreeCADv0.17バージョンは多くの改良が加えられてリリースされています。